From af92968ba2b860e15a2fcf77933fef60dd17997c Mon Sep 17 00:00:00 2001
From: adiouf <adiouf@afi-sa.fr>
Date: Tue, 9 May 2017 14:08:27 +0200
Subject: [PATCH] dev #59639 Multimedia supprimer besoin auth pour question
 devices : fix retour revue tech

---
 .../modules/opac/controllers/MultimediaController.php |  8 ++++----
 library/Class/Multimedia/AbstractRequest.php          |  6 +++---
 library/Class/Multimedia/AuthenticateRequest.php      | 11 -----------
 library/Class/Multimedia/HoldRequest.php              | 11 -----------
 4 files changed, 7 insertions(+), 29 deletions(-)

diff --git a/application/modules/opac/controllers/MultimediaController.php b/application/modules/opac/controllers/MultimediaController.php
index 66e48552ed7..d0d49235c81 100644
--- a/application/modules/opac/controllers/MultimediaController.php
+++ b/application/modules/opac/controllers/MultimediaController.php
@@ -38,7 +38,7 @@ class MultimediaController extends ZendAfi_Controller_Action {
     $response = new StdClass();
     $response->auth = 0;
 
-    $request = Class_Multimedia_AuthenticateRequest::getInstance()->authenticate($this->_request);
+    $request = (new Class_Multimedia_AuthenticateRequest())->authenticate($this->_request);
 
     if (!$request->isValid()) {
       $response->error = $request->getError();
@@ -61,7 +61,7 @@ class MultimediaController extends ZendAfi_Controller_Action {
     $response = new StdClass();
     $response->auth = 0;
 
-    $request = Class_Multimedia_HoldRequest::getInstance()->holdDevice($this->_request);
+    $request = (new Class_Multimedia_HoldRequest())->holdDevice($this->_request);
 
     if ($user = $request->getUser())
       $response = $this->_initInfosUser($user, $response);
@@ -87,7 +87,7 @@ class MultimediaController extends ZendAfi_Controller_Action {
     $response = new StdClass();
     $response->auth = 0;
 
-    $request = Class_Multimedia_HoldRequest::getInstance()->closeHoldingDevice($this->_request);
+    $request = (new Class_Multimedia_HoldRequest())>closeHoldingDevice($this->_request);
 
     if (!$request->isValid()) {
       $response->error = $request->getError();
@@ -106,7 +106,7 @@ class MultimediaController extends ZendAfi_Controller_Action {
 
     $response = new StdClass();
 
-    $request = Class_Multimedia_HoldRequest::getInstance()->isHoldableDay($this->_request);
+    $request = (new Class_Multimedia_HoldRequest())->isHoldableDay($this->_request);
 
     if (!$request->isValid()) {
       $response->error = $request->getError();
diff --git a/library/Class/Multimedia/AbstractRequest.php b/library/Class/Multimedia/AbstractRequest.php
index 813fd5be718..4f6d264a598 100644
--- a/library/Class/Multimedia/AbstractRequest.php
+++ b/library/Class/Multimedia/AbstractRequest.php
@@ -47,9 +47,9 @@ class Class_Multimedia_AbstractRequest {
     if (!$auth->authenticateLoginPassword($login,
                                           $password,
                                           [$auth->newAuthSIGB(), $auth->newAuthDb()])) {
-      if (Class_Users::findFirstBy(['login' => $login]))
-        return $this->_error('PasswordIsWrong');
-      return  $this->_error('UserNotFound');
+      return (Class_Users::findFirstBy(['login' => $login]))
+        ? $this->_error('PasswordIsWrong')
+        :  $this->_error('UserNotFound');
     }
 
     $user = Class_Users::getIdentity();
diff --git a/library/Class/Multimedia/AuthenticateRequest.php b/library/Class/Multimedia/AuthenticateRequest.php
index d63208f028e..656fd8683df 100644
--- a/library/Class/Multimedia/AuthenticateRequest.php
+++ b/library/Class/Multimedia/AuthenticateRequest.php
@@ -21,17 +21,6 @@
 
 class Class_Multimedia_AuthenticateRequest extends Class_Multimedia_AbstractRequest{
 
-
-  /**
-   * @param Zend_Controller_Request_Abstract
-   * @return Class_Multimedia_AuthenticateRequest
-   */
-
-  public static function getInstance() {
-    return new self();
-  }
-
-
   /**
    * @param Zend_Controller_Request_Abstract
    * @return Class_Multimedia_AuthenticateRequest
diff --git a/library/Class/Multimedia/HoldRequest.php b/library/Class/Multimedia/HoldRequest.php
index 0611e05fd7d..001753e6306 100644
--- a/library/Class/Multimedia/HoldRequest.php
+++ b/library/Class/Multimedia/HoldRequest.php
@@ -37,17 +37,6 @@ class Class_Multimedia_HoldRequest extends Class_Multimedia_AbstractRequest{
     /** @var boolean */
   protected $_successHolding = false;
 
-
-  /**
-   * @param Zend_Controller_Request_Abstract
-   * @return Class_Multimedia_HoldRequest
-   */
-
-  public static function getInstance() {
-    return new self();
-  }
-
-
   /**
    * @param Zend_Controller_Request_Abstract
    * @return Class_Multimedia_HoldRequest
-- 
GitLab